What really sets Hello Kitty Island Adventure apart for me is the balance between structured quests and free-form exploration, much like Animal Crossing, but with its own flavor. You’re not just building a town; you’re uncovering a whole island full of secrets, solving puzzles with clever character abilities, and forging deep friendships with all the Sanrio pals. It really expands on the concept of friendship and community in a way that feels organic and heartwarming. Each character has their own unique story arcs and friendship levels, making every interaction meaningful. Crafting new tools, cooking delicious recipes (hello, perfect soufflé!), and decorating your cabin are all part of the daily routine, making every play session feel productive and relaxing.
